Riots in Tunisia and Egypt – different causes, the same consequences

Topic:Political crisis in Egypt

The first month of 2011 was marked by large-scale anti-government protests in Tunisia and Egypt. Can we talk about a trend and can we expect new uprisings in other Arab countries? What are the common traits and what is the difference between the events in Tunisia and Egypt? Vasily Kuznetsov, PhD. in History, and Research Fellow at the Russian Academy of Sciences  Institute of Oriental Studies shares his views on the present situation in the Arab world.
